Typical Appliance Repair Costs

Average pricing for common services in Glendora

Appliance repair costs in Glendora can range significantly based on the appliance type and repair complexity. Simple repairs like replacing a dryer belt or refrigerator door seal might cost less than more complex issues involving compressors, control boards, or specialized components.

Diagnostic fees typically range from $75-$150, with many technicians applying this fee toward the total repair cost if you proceed. Labor for common repairs often falls within a predictable range, but complex issues requiring specialized expertise or hard-to-find parts can increase costs substantially.

Always ask for a detailed estimate that separates diagnostic fees, labor, and parts costs before authorizing any work.

Pricing Questions

Common questions about appliance repair costs in Glendora

💬 What's included in a typical diagnostic fee?

Diagnostic fees typically cover the technician's time to assess the problem, identify the faulty component, and provide a repair estimate. Many local technicians apply this fee toward the total repair cost if you proceed with their service. Always ask about diagnostic fee policies before scheduling.

💬 How much do emergency appliance repairs cost in Glendora?

Emergency repairs typically cost 30-50% more than standard service due to after-hours or weekend scheduling. Some technicians have minimum emergency service charges. For non-urgent issues, scheduling during regular business hours can save significantly on labor costs.

💬 Are there additional fees I should watch for?

Watch for travel fees, minimum service charges, disposal fees for old parts, and potential trip charges if multiple visits are needed. Reputable technicians should disclose all potential fees upfront. Ask about any additional charges that might apply to your specific situation.

💬 Should I repair or replace my appliance?

As a general rule, if repair costs exceed 50% of the appliance's replacement value or the appliance is over 10 years old, replacement may be more cost-effective. However, this depends on the specific appliance, brand reliability, and your budget. A qualified technician can help you weigh the options.

💬 How can I verify a technician's credentials in Glendora?

Check for California contractor's license if required for the repair type, verify business registration with Los Angeles County, request proof of liability insurance, and check online reviews from local customers. Reputable technicians should willingly provide this information.

💬 What payment terms are typical for appliance repairs?

Most technicians require payment upon completion of satisfactory work. Some may request a deposit for expensive parts. Be cautious of requests for full payment upfront. Credit cards often provide additional consumer protection compared to cash payments.
